Avoid Repair Headaches with Routine Appliance Maintenance

Appliance maintenance is key to preventing costly breakdowns. Minor issues, when left unattended, can escalate into major problems. Appliances like dryers, washers, and refrigerators rely on several functioning components to run properly.

  • Clogged dryer vents can overheat and damage the heating element.
  • Dirty refrigerator coils make the compressor work harder and increase repair costs.

Routine maintenance lets you address small problems before they turn into expensive breakdowns.

Maintenance Tips

  • Vacuum refrigerator coils every 6 months to ensure optimal cooling.
  • Inspect washing machine hoses for damage and replace every 5 years.
  • Clean dryer lint traps after each cycle and vacuum vents yearly.
  • Descale dishwashers and coffee makers monthly to maintain efficiency.
  • Check oven seals and replace them if damaged to prevent heat loss.
